Unlocking Mental Wellness Through the Lens of CBT: Cognitive Behavioural Therapy

Posted on June 21, 2024 by BarbaraJDostal

When it comes to achieving mental wellness, CBT, Cognitive Behavioural Therapy, stands as one of the most effective and evidence-based approaches. This therapeutic method has gained widespread recognition for its structured approach to treating a range of psychological issues, from anxiety and depression to phobias and addiction.

Understanding the Core Principles of CBT

Cognitive Behavioural Therapy, or CBT, is a form of psychotherapy that primarily focuses on the relationship between thoughts, emotions, and behaviours. The fundamental premise is that our thoughts have a direct impact on how we feel and act. By identifying and challenging irrational or unhelpful thought patterns, individuals can modify their emotional responses and behavioural actions.

The Cognitive Component

The cognitive aspect of Cognitive Behavioural Therapy involves analyzing one’s thought patterns. Negative or distorted thinking patterns, often referred to as cognitive distortions, can lead to mental health issues. Common cognitive distortions include all-or-nothing thinking, overgeneralization, and catastrophizing. CBT targets these distortions, helping individuals to reframe their thinking in a more balanced and rational manner.

The Behavioural Component

The behavioural element focuses on examining and altering behaviours that contribute to the individual’s issues. Through techniques such as exposure therapy, behavioural experiments, and activity scheduling, Cognitive Behavioural Therapy encourages individuals to engage in healthier behaviours, which can lead to improved emotional states and overall well-being.

Applications and Effectiveness of CBT

One of the most significant benefits of CBT, Cognitive Behavioural Therapy, is its broad applicability. It is successfully used to treat conditions such as:

  • Anxiety Disorders
  • Depression
  • Obsessive-Compulsive Disorder (OCD)
  • Post-Traumatic Stress Disorder (PTSD)
  • Phobias
  • Substance Abuse

Studies have shown that CBT can be as effective as, or even more effective than, medication for some conditions. Moreover, the skills and techniques learned in therapy sessions can serve as a long-term toolset, empowering individuals to maintain mental wellness even after formal therapy concludes.

The Process of Engaging in CBT

Engaging in Cognitive Behavioural Therapy typically involves a series of structured sessions with a trained therapist. Initial sessions focus on building a rapport and understanding the issues at hand. Subsequent sessions delve into identifying specific thought patterns and behaviours that need changing. Practical exercises and homework assignments are often given to encourage the application of new skills in real-world scenarios.

Customizing CBT

One of the strengths of CBT is its adaptability. Therapists can tailor the approach to meet the specific needs and circumstances of each individual. This personalization ensures that therapy remains relevant and effective, enhancing the likelihood of positive outcomes.
